摘要

The interactions of four antitumor azolato-bridged dinuclear platinum(II) complexes, [{cis-Pt(NH3)2}2(μ-OH)(μ-azolato)]2+, with calf thymus DNA were monitored dose- and time-dependently, by using circular dichroism. Complexes 1–4 reacted with DNA via a two-step interaction that comprised a prompt diffusion-controlled reaction, which induced a B- to C-form transition, and a relatively slow temperature-dependent reaction.
